网页设计已经成为了一种重要的视觉传达手段。在众多网页元素中,日历样式CSS以其独特的魅力,成为了网页设计中不可或缺的一部分。本文将从日历样式CSS的设计之美、用户体验以及实现方法等方面进行探讨,以期为网页设计师提供一些有益的启示。

一、日历样式CSS的设计之美

1. 视觉统一性

日历样式CSS在设计中追求视觉统一性,使整个页面呈现出和谐的美感。设计师通过对日历的字体、颜色、布局等方面进行精心设计,使日历与网页整体风格相得益彰。例如,简洁的线条、清晰的字体、鲜明的色彩搭配,都能使日历样式CSS展现出独特的视觉美感。

日历样式CSS设计之美与用户体验的完美融合

2. 个性化设计

在日历样式CSS的设计中,个性化设计至关重要。设计师可以根据网页主题、品牌形象等因素,为日历添加独特的元素,如图标、图片、动画等。这些个性化设计既能提升日历的趣味性,又能增强用户对网站的印象。

3. 适应性设计

随着移动设备的普及,网页设计需要具备良好的适应性。日历样式CSS在设计过程中,要充分考虑不同设备屏幕尺寸和分辨率,实现响应式布局。这样,用户在手机、平板、电脑等设备上浏览网页时,都能获得良好的阅读体验。

二、日历样式CSS的用户体验

1. 便捷性

日历样式CSS的设计要注重便捷性,使用户能够轻松查看、选择日期。例如,提供日期筛选、快速跳转等功能,方便用户快速找到所需的日期。

2. 易用性

日历样式CSS的布局要简洁明了,避免过于复杂的操作。设计师可以通过合理的布局、清晰的指示,引导用户完成操作。要考虑到不同用户的使用习惯,为用户提供多样化的操作方式。

3. 信息传达

日历样式CSS要注重信息传达,将日期、事件等信息以直观、清晰的方式呈现给用户。例如,通过颜色、图标等方式,区分不同类型的日期和事件,提高用户对信息的识别度。

三、日历样式CSS的实现方法

1. HTML结构

在实现日历样式CSS之前,首先要构建HTML结构。通常,一个日历由头部、主体和底部三个部分组成。头部包含年月、标题等元素;主体为日期展示区域;底部为辅助功能按钮等。

2. CSS样式

CSS样式是日历样式CSS的核心。设计师可以通过以下方法实现:

(1)设置日历整体样式,如背景、颜色、字体等。

(2)设计日期显示区域,包括日期布局、颜色、字体等。

(3)添加辅助功能,如筛选、跳转等。

(4)实现响应式布局,适应不同设备屏幕尺寸。

3. JavaScript脚本

JavaScript脚本可以增强日历的功能,如日期选择、事件提醒等。以下是一些常用JavaScript库和插件:

(1)moment.js:用于处理日期和时间。

(2)FullCalendar:一个功能强大的日历插件。

(3)Pickadate.js:一个轻量级的日期选择器。

日历样式CSS作为网页设计中的一部分,具有独特的美感和实用性。设计师在创作过程中,要注重设计之美、用户体验以及实现方法,以实现日历样式CSS与网页的完美融合。随着技术的不断发展,日历样式CSS将不断优化,为用户提供更加便捷、舒适的浏览体验。

参考文献:

[1] 张晓亮. 网页设计中的日历元素[J]. 美术大观,2019(5):193-194.

[2] 王芳. 网页设计中日历样式CSS的设计与实现[J]. 计算机与现代化,2018(5):127-128.

[3] 陈思. 基于响应式设计的日历样式CSS实现[J]. 科技信息,2017(22):299-300.